The odds in favor of the occurrence of an event are 8 : 13. Find the probability that the event will occur.

Answer»

We know that, 

If odds in favor of the occurrence an event are a:b, then the probability of an event to occur is  \(\frac{a}{a+b}\) , which indirectly came from 

Probability of the occurrence of an event

\(\frac{Total\,no.of\,Desired\,outcomes}{Total\,no.of\,outcomes}\)

Where, Total no. of desired outcomes = a, and total no. of outcomes = a + b 

Given a = 8, b= 13 

The probability that the event occurs 

\(\frac{8}{8+13}\) 

\(\frac{8}{21}\)

Conclusion: Probability that the event occurs is  \(\frac{8}{21}\)
